About Eldersburg
Eldersburg is a suburb in the Baltimore Metro Area and in the Carroll County. It has a population of 30,550 and a population density of 789, which is 88% above the national average. It has a median age of 41, which is 3 years above the Baltimore Metro median age and 3 years above the national average.
Eldersburg has a median home value of $486,300, which is 23% above the Metro average.The average rent of $2,499 is 28% above the metro average rent and 58% above the national average rent. The average household income in Eldersburg is $125,981 , which is 33% above the Metro average household income and 48% above the national average of household income.
The average school rating in Eldersburg is 9. Eldersburg also has a crime index 29 that is below the Metro average and below the National average, making it one of the best places to raise a family in Baltimore.

Demographics
Eldersburg's population is made up of 61% married, 27% single, 8% divorced and 4% widowed. Baby Boomers make up the largest percentage of the population at 38%, while Millennials have the second largest segment at 23%. Homeowners make up 88% of the population in Eldersburg.
- 49% Male
- 51% Female
Employment
The Per Capita income in Eldersburg is $51,154. The Median Household Income is $125,981 and the Eldersburg Unemployment Rate is 3%.

Crime Index represents the risk of crime occurring in a area and is measured against national index of 100. If the Crime Index of an area is above 100 the crime in that area is relatively higher when compared to US. If the Crime Index of an area is below 100 the crime in that area is lower when compared to US.
